Company DescriptionAstucemedia is a global leader in innovative creative and software solutions for real-time data visualization on live TV, studios, museums, immersive experiences, and sports venues. Our software and services enhance augmented reality graphics, virtual sets, video walls, interactive apps, and on-screen overlays across television and digital platforms.We’re a team of passionate trailblazers who thrive on creativity, collaboration, and cutting-edge technology—and we’re looking for someone who’s just as excited to shape the future with us.Job DescriptionWe are seeking a motivated, resourceful, and sharp IT Support Technician to provide on-site technical support at our Montreal office.This is a flexible, part-time position operating on a casual/as-needed basis, averaging up to 1 to 2 days per week depending on operational needs and office deployments. It is a perfect fit for a tech-savvy individual looking for a versatile role in a creative and highly technological environment.This role goes far beyond traditional IT ticketing. You will be our go-to, semi-internal resource handling day-to-day office needs, working alongside our external IT provider and office coordinator.Qualifications1. User Support & Office LogisticsProvide quick, efficient, and friendly Tier 1 (day-to-day) tech support to on-site employees.Take ownership of conference room setups—proactively troubleshooting ongoing issues (audio/video, projection, and Teams/Zoom connectivity).Maintain general office IT health, including internet connectivity, printers, and general peripheral troubleshooting.2. Workstation & Equipment ManagementSet up, configure, maintain, and image workstations (PC and Mac) for existing staff and onboarding new hires.Manage, wire, and physically organize network equipment and hardware at the office.Assist with routine physical security backups and local data maintenance.Qualifications & ProfilePractical IT experience, currently pursuing or possessing a background in an IT-related field (Computer Science, Software/IT Engineering, or a DEC/AEC in Network Administration / IT Support).Technical Skills:Familiarity with both Windows and macOS environments.Basic understanding of networking concepts (Wi-Fi, routers, cabling, IP addresses).Comfort setting up and troubleshooting hardware, audio/video gear, and office equipment.Core Competencies:Resourcefulness & Fast LearnerHighly motivated and capable of working independently as the main IT contact on-site.A genuine interest in creative environments, media infrastructure, and an aspiration to learn DevOps methodologies.Additional InformationWork ConditionsEmployment Status: Part-Time / Casual Employee (Salarié sur appel / à horaire variable).Hours: Variable based on office needs, averaging up to 1 to 2 days per week (approximately 8 to 15 hours/week). No fixed weekly minimum is guaranteed.Flexibility: Adaptable scheduling to accommodate academic course blocks or exam schedules, with the ability to adjust availability from semester to semester.Location: On-site at our Montreal office. Compensation: up to CAD 25 - hourly
